Description
One drill bit replaces two drill bits (1 glass and tile core bit + 1 Mansonry core drill bit), ideal for drilling insertion holes in bathroom tiles or wall mirrors.Once drilled through tile or mirror, this drill bit will easily adapt to any masonry behind it.5-piece drill bit set with 4 different sizes: 2 x 6 mm (1/4 inch), 1 x 8 mm (5/16 in), 1 x 10 mm (3/8 in), 1 x 12 mm (1/2 in)U-type slot design with quick drilling dust removal; 3-flat shank allows the drill bit to be held firmly and stably in the electric drill.When drilling hard materials (glass, porcelain tile, marble, or granite), use water for lubrication.Material: Tungsten carbideShank: 3-flat shankColor: Black and silverUses for: Tile, concrete, brick, Glass, plastic, wood, etc.High-quality, durable, and precise drilling in various materials simultaneously; convenient for long-term use.Tool: Electric drill.Do not use the impact mode of the drill or hammers.Package Contents: 2 x 6mm (1/4 inch) Drill Bits1 x 8mm (5/16 inch) Drill Bits1 x 10mm (3/8 inch) Drill Bits1 x 12mm (1/2 inch) Drill BitOnly the above package contents are included; other products are not included.Note: Light shooting and different displays may cause the color of the item in the picture to be slightly different from the real thing.The measurement allowed error is +/- 1-3 cm.
